RhinoCommons UnitOfWork Вопрос с ASP.Net MVC

Я играю с RhinoCommons и NHibernate, и у меня возник вопрос о шаблоне UnitOfWork.

Извините, если это вопрос n00b.

Должен ли UnitOfWork запускаться на самом высоком уровне (т. Е. На контроллере)? Или сказать в сервисном модуле, что контроллер вызывает вниз?

2 ответа

Решение

Используйте UnitOfWorkApplication. Вот как.

Я думаю, что UnitOfWork должен быть сервисным средством, а не частью ответственности контроллера.

Другие вопросы по тегам